The is a mountain, 780.8 m above sea level, near Schnett in the municipality of ) in the county of Hildburghausen in Germany. It is the main summit of a forked mountain chain, which runs along the boundary between the and the from towards the southwest and is bounded by the valleys of the Schleuse and its tributary, the Biber.
